Tomorrowland's stage also caught fire in Barcelona in 2017

This isn't the first time a Tomorrowland main stage has caught fire. In 2017, the main stage also caught fire in Barcelona at a sister event of Tomorrowland. At that time, the festival was already in full swing, and the site had to be evacuated immediately.

The event took place at Parc de Can Zam, in northeast Barcelona. The fire broke out just before closing DJ Steve Aoki's set, which was subsequently canceled. Over 20,000 festival-goers were evacuated. The cause was declared a"technical defect" at the time.

Unite was an initiative where Tomorrowland organized sister events in eight different countries. Visitors could also watch some acts in Belgium livestreamed on large screens via a satellite connection.

Can the festival go ahead?

Now that the fire appears to be under control, the key question is whether the festival can go ahead. There's been no communication on this yet. Fortunately for the organizers, the De Schorre site in Boom is large and has 14 other stages, most of them much smaller than the main stage.

The question now is whether the 70,000 visitors can be safely distributed across the rest of the site, just like the artists scheduled for the main stage. A further question is whether other infrastructure necessary for the festival's safety, such as the generators for the lighting and emergency exits, was also damaged.

Images show that the fire on the main stage has been largely extinguished: only the steel structure remains standing

Images show that the fire on the main stage has been largely extinguished. The entire set has burned down. What remains is a steel skeleton around which the entire stage is being clad.

A colossal stage in the flames

What a major international artist is for Rock Werchter, the main stage is for Tomorrowland. The main stage is the true face of the festival. The main stage isn't actually a real stage, but a huge wall with screens and fantasy set pieces. The DJs who perform on the main stage stand on a small platform. The stage's dimensions are gigantic: 160 meters wide and 45 meters high. This year's set also included 65 fountains and two waterfalls. The stage is constructed from Layher scaffolding, combined with Stageco tower elements. The set pieces and screens are attached to these. The images also show the sound towers and large LED screens ablaze. The sound and lighting equipment alone, now ablaze, cost millions of euros.

Camping Dreamville should normally open its doors tomorrow

Normally, campers would already be arriving near the festival grounds tomorrow, a day before the official start of the festival. That's when the Dreamville campsite opens with The Gathering, a party for tens of thousands of campers. The organizers can't yet say whether that will go ahead.

Alert to local residents:"Close windows and doors"

Local residents are receiving a message on their phones from the government service Be-alert asking them to close their windows and doors."There is currently a fire raging on the Tomorrowland site, with fireworks exploding. Close your windows and doors. Smoke is a nuisance but not toxic," the full message reads.
